About

Saint Leo University is a higher education institution located in Pasco County, FL. In 2024, the most popular Masters Degree concentrations at Saint Leo University were General Business Administration & Management (293 degrees awarded), Computer Science (170 degrees), and Social Work (100 degrees).

In 2024, 2,418 degrees were awarded across all undergraduate and graduate programs at Saint Leo University. 59.7% of these degrees were awarded to women, and 40.3% awarded men. The most common race/ethnicity group of degree recipients was white (835 degrees), 1.56 times more than then the next closest race/ethnicity group, black or african american (536 degrees).

Costs

In 2024, the median undergraduate tuition at Saint Leo University is $27,880, which is $2,592 more than the national average for Masters Colleges and Universities ($25,288).

After taking grants and loans into account, the average net price for students is $22,599.

In 2024, 53% of undergraduate students attending Saint Leo University received financial aid through grants. Comparatively, 32% of undergraduate students received financial aid through loans.

Admissions

Saint Leo University received 6,684 undergraduate applications in 2024, which represents a 14.2% annual growth. Out of those 6,684 applicants, 5,240 students were accepted for enrollment, representing a 78.4% acceptance rate.

There were 9,692 students enrolled at Saint Leo University in 2024. 8% of first-time enrollees submitted SAT scores with their applications.

Saint Leo University has an overall enrollment yield of 13%, which represents the number of admitted students who ended up enrolling.

Enrollment

Saint Leo University had a total enrollment of 9,692 students in 2024. The full-time enrollment at Saint Leo University is 5,506 students and the part-time enrollment is 4,186. This means that 56.8% of students enrolled at Saint Leo University are enrolled full-time.

The enrolled student population at Saint Leo University, both undergraduate and graduate, is 24.9% White, 17.7% Black or African American, 14.7% Hispanic or Latino, 1.28% Two or More Races, 0.97% Asian, 0.237% American Indian or Alaska Native, and 0.103% Native Hawaiian or Other Pacific Islanders.

Students enrolled at Saint Leo University in full-time Undergraduate programs are most commonly White Female (15.6%), followed by Hispanic or Latino Female (11.5%) and White Male (10.6%). Students enrolled in full-time Graduate programs are most commonly White Female (22.2%), followed by Black or African American Female (19.9%) and White Male (10.4%).

Retention Rate over Time

59%
2024 Retention Rate

Retention rate measures the number of first-time students who began their studies the previous fall and returned to school the following fall. The retention rate for full-time undergraduates at Saint Leo University was 59%. Compared with the full-time retention rate at similar Masters Colleges and Universities (74%), Saint Leo University had a retention rate lower than its peers.

Operations

Saint Leo University has an endowment valued at nearly $76.1M, as of the end of the 2024 fiscal year. The return on its endowment was of 6.63M (8.72%) compared to the 9.96% average return (5.41M on 54.3M) across all Masters Colleges and Universities.

In 2024, Saint Leo University had a total salary expenditure of 116M. Saint Leo University employs 32 Associate professors, 19 Professors and 16 Assistant professors. Most academics at Saint Leo University are Female Associate professor (17), Male Associate professor (15), and Male Professor (11).

The most common positions for non-instructional staff at Saint Leo University are: Management, with 105 employees, Service, with 99 employees, and Sales and related with 49 employees.
